When it comes to facilities, Borough Green & Wrotham train station has got you covered. Ticketing is straightforward, with a ticket office open during most of the week, complemented by user-friendly ticket machines. If you've purchased your tickets online, collection is a breeze from these machines located within the station forecourt. For those who utilize technology, smartcards can be issued here, although you'll need to validate them elsewhere.
Supporting passengers with additional needs is also a priority, with partially step-free access to platforms and an accessible ticket machine available at the station forecourt. Information is freely accessible from both staff and help points, ensuring every traveler feels supported on their journey. Staff assistance is available during most daytime hours, with a dedicated helpline to provide navigation help throughout the station. Amenities such as toilets, including accessible types, are open during station staffing hours ensuring a comfortable wait for your train.
As part of the Southeastern rail network, Borough Green & Wrotham offers a wide array of connections, both by train and by other means. The station is equipped with cycle storage for those preferring to pedal to this commute point, offering shelters to keep bicycles dry, though users take responsibility for their bikes' security.
Bus services connect directly via a stop at the Station Approach Road. For onward travel, a ta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the station, making it easier to continue your journey without hassle. The station is well-equipped with facilities to make your journey comfortable and efficient.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 22: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:30 to 17:30 on Sundays, complemented by ticket machines that accommodate all travelers, including those with disabilities. If you're collecting pre-purchased tickets, simply head to one of the designated machines. Located in the booking hall, these machines are designed for accessibility, ensuring ease for all travelers.
For passenger assistance, customers can seek help from various help points throughout the station, whether it's from the staff, information points, or through announcements displayed on numerous screens. While there isn’t luggage storage available, Stratford International remains a secure station with comprehensive CCTV coverage.
If you have some time before your train, indulge in a cup of coffee at the refreshment facilities or grab essentials from WH Smiths. The station also features ATMs for your convenience. However, if you're planning to bring your own bicycle, you’ll find 66 stands available for bike parking, albeit at your own risk.
Ensuring accessibility is a core aim of Stratford International. The station offers step-free access throughout, including lifts connecting all platforms. Accessible toilets and ticket machines make the station inclusive, and passengers can request assistance up to two hours before their travel through the Passenger Assist service.
Stratford International is not just about trains; it's a multimodal transport hub. Situated near the Docklands Light Railway (DLR), passengers can easily connect to the London Underground and explore a vast range of destinations. Taxis are readily accessible at the Westfield Shopping Centre entrance, and if there are any disruptions, a rail replacement service operates from the station forecourt.
